Output 73223d6ff75e931d529b85884310cfcaa159ba91a8d612f2b8a4e955ca5dfd86:2

value
162170651
script pubkey
OP_0 OP_PUSHBYTES_20 d5fe1a44c39134bd368b0832150a3d7117358d71
address
bc1q6hlp53xrjy6t6d5tpqep2z3awytntrt3nh8kxq
transaction
73223d6ff75e931d529b85884310cfcaa159ba91a8d612f2b8a4e955ca5dfd86
confirmations
122656
spent
true